- 1、有哪些信誉好的足球投注网站(book118)网站文档一经付费(服务费),不意味着购买了该文档的版权,仅供个人/单位学习、研究之用,不得用于商业用途,未经授权,严禁复制、发行、汇编、翻译或者网络传播等,侵权必究。。
- 2、本站所有内容均由合作方或网友上传,本站不对文档的完整性、权威性及其观点立场正确性做任何保证或承诺!文档内容仅供研究参考,付费前请自行鉴别。如您付费,意味着您自己接受本站规则且自行承担风险,本站不退款、不进行额外附加服务;查看《如何避免下载的几个坑》。如果您已付费下载过本站文档,您可以点击 这里二次下载。
- 3、如文档侵犯商业秘密、侵犯著作权、侵犯人身权等,请点击“版权申诉”(推荐),也可以打举报电话:400-050-0827(电话支持时间:9:00-18:30)。
查看更多
* 华中农业大学信息学院 * SET交易类型(2) * 华中农业大学信息学院 * 持卡者注册 持卡者初始注册 CA发出响应 持卡者接收到响应并请求注册表 CA处理请求和发送适当的注册表 持卡者接收注册表,并请求证书 CA处理请求和产生证书(有关帐号信息的HASH值将成为证书中的一部分内容) 持卡者接收证书 * 华中农业大学信息学院 * 商家注册 商家请求注册表 CA发出响应 商家接收注册表和请求证书 CA处理请求和产生证书 商家接收证书 * 华中农业大学信息学院 * 购买请求 持卡者初始化购买请求 持卡者完成浏览、挑选、定购后,SET协议启动。提供订购表完全的内容、选择支付卡品牌、请求支付网关证书。 商家发出证书 商家为请求消息制定一个唯一的交易识别号,将商家和相应的支付网关证书一起发给持卡者。 持卡者接收响应和发出请求 持卡者检验响应的证书并保存候用,产生有效的OI和PI,并进行双签名,将PI和OI封装数字信封,发送给商家。 商家处理请求消息 验证持卡者证书,验证数字信封的数字签名。 持卡者接收购买响应 验证,并更新本地定购状态数据库。 * 华中农业大学信息学院 * 持卡者购买请求构造 * 华中农业大学信息学院 * 商家购买请求验证 * 华中农业大学信息学院 * 支付授权 商家请求授权:商家产生一个安全的授权请求,发送给支付网关。 购买相关信息:PI/双签名/OI摘要/持卡者数字信封 认可相关信息:认证分组(商家签名交易标识)和商家数字信封 证书:持卡人签名证书、商家签名证书、商家密钥交换证书 支付网关处理授权请求 安全验证,解密PI,验证与OI的一致性和关联性,通过后支付网关将通过一个支付系统向发卡行发出一个授权请求。一旦从发卡行接收到一个授权响应,支付网关将签署一个授权认可消息,安全处理后发送给商家。 商家处理响应 验证有效性,保存授权认可消息和请款标识(Capture Token)。 * 华中农业大学信息学院 * 支付请款 商家请求支付 商家产生一个请款请求(包含交易金额、交易标识等),和请款标识一起发给支付网关。 支付网关处理请款请求 验证请款请求的有效性,得到请款标识,形成清算请求,并创建清算请求,通过一个支付卡系统发给发卡行。并给商家发送请款响应消息。 商家接收响应 商家验证有效性,并保存请款响应消息,以备与收单行得到的付款进行对帐。 * 华中农业大学信息学院 * 第17章作业 思考题 习题 * * 华中农业大学信息学院 * 密钥导出 * 华中农业大学信息学院 * Master_secret的产生 SSL 3.0 Master_secret = MD5(pre_master_secret‖SHA-1(‘A’‖pre_master_secret|| ClientHello.random ‖ServerHello.random)) ‖ MD5(pre_master_secret‖SHA-1(‘BB’‖pre_master_secret|| ClientHello.random ‖ServerHello.random)) ‖ MD5(pre_master_secret‖SHA-1(‘CCC’‖pre_master_secret|| ClientHello.random ‖ServerHello.random)) TLS 1.0 master_secret = PRF(pre_master_secret, “master secret” , ClientHello.random, + ServerHello.random)[0..47] * PRF(secret, label, seed)为伪随机函数 * 华中农业大学信息学院 * 伪随机函数PRF(secret, label, seed) P_hash(secret, seed) = +HMAC_hash(secret, A(1) + seed)+HMAC_hash(secret, A(2) + seed) +HMAC_hash(secret, A(3) + seed)+ ... 这里A()定义如下: A(0) = seed A(i) = HMAC_hash(secret, A(i-1)) 伪随机函数 PRF(secret, label, seed) =P_MD5(S1, label + seed) XOR P_SHA-1(S2, label + seed); 这里,S1和S2为secret的各一半,如果secret为奇数个字节,则S1和S2共享一个字节 * 华中农业大学信息学院 * 最终需要的密钥导出 * 华中农业大学信息学院
您可能关注的文档
最近下载
- (高清版)B-T 2099.1-2021 家用和类似用途插头插座 第1部分:通用要求.pdf VIP
- 劳动创造美好生活中职生劳动教育全套教学课件.pptx
- 人工智能在高中美术课堂中的应用.pdf
- 西藏自治区日喀则市高一入学数学分班考试真题含答案.docx VIP
- 2025黑龙江省建设投资集团有限公司面向系统内部及社会招聘12人笔试备考试题及答案解析.docx VIP
- 医院医德医风考评公示制度医德医风考评制度及考评实施细则.docx
- 晶体工程资料.pdf VIP
- 成都川师锦华小升初入学分班考试英语考试试题及答案.docx VIP
- 第六章晶体工程.ppt VIP
- ASUS华硕ROG SWIFT PG65UQ中文说明书.pdf VIP
文档评论(0)